Why Board and Batten Behaves Differently in Ferndale's Climate
Ferndale sits in Whatcom County close enough to the Salish Sea coastline and the Nooksack River lowlands that homes here deal with a steady diet of marine humidity, salt-laden wind, and long stretches of driving rain most of the year. Add the shaded, damp conditions that let moss and algae take hold on north-facing walls and rooflines, and you have a climate that is genuinely tough on exterior materials — especially a siding style built around vertical seams.
Board and batten is a vertical profile: wide boards with narrower strips (battens) covering the joints between them. That vertical orientation is part of what makes it look so good on Ferndale homes, but it also means water runs differently than it does on horizontal lap siding. Every seam, every batten edge, and every transition at a window or foundation line is a place where wind-driven rain can find its way behind the surface if the assembly underneath isn't built correctly. In a climate this wet, "looks right from the street" and "is actually keeping water out" are two different things, and the gap between them shows up as rot, staining, or paint failure a few years down the road.

What Board and Batten Siding Actually Is
Traditional board and batten started as a simple barn-building technique: wide boards nailed vertically with a narrower strip covering each seam to block wind and water. On a modern home, that same look is achieved with engineered panel systems rather than raw lumber, which is a good thing — the vertical shadow lines and clean, linear look that make board and batten popular on Pacific Northwest homes depend on the boards staying straight, flat, and consistently spaced over decades, not just for the first few seasons.
The style reads as farmhouse-modern, but it's really a system: field panels, vertical battens, trim at corners and openings, and flashing at every horizontal break. Get any one piece wrong and the whole wall's performance suffers, even if the finished look seems fine at install.
Why We Install Board and Batten Only in James Hardie Fiber Cement
Board and batten is one of the least forgiving siding profiles for material choice, because the vertical channels between boards are exactly where standing moisture likes to collect. That's a real problem for wood and engineered-wood board and batten products, which can swell, cup, or rot at those seams once the factory coating is compromised — and in a climate with Ferndale's rainfall and humidity, that coating gets tested constantly. Vinyl board and batten avoids the rot question but brings its own trade-offs: it can look visibly synthetic up close, and it's prone to warping or fading under repeated wet-dry and UV cycling.
We standardized on James Hardie fiber cement for board and batten work because it's engineered for exactly this kind of exposure. HardiePanel vertical siding paired with HardieTrim battens gives you the same crisp look without wood's moisture sensitivity — fiber cement doesn't swell, warp, or feed rot the way wood-based products can. The factory-applied ColorPlus finish is baked on under controlled conditions and holds color and adhesion far better against moss, algae, and salt air than field-applied paint, which matters a lot in a region where those are constant, not occasional, stressors. Hardie's siding is also non-combustible, which is a genuine safety advantage regardless of climate.
What a Correct Board and Batten Installation Involves
A Working Rainscreen Gap
Behind the panels, there needs to be a drainage gap — typically created with vertical furring strips or a purpose-built rainscreen product — so any moisture that does get past the surface can drain and the wall can dry out. Skipping this gap and fastening panels flat against the weather barrier is one of the most common shortcuts on vertical siding, and it's exactly the kind of shortcut that doesn't show up as a problem until years later.
Flashing at Every Horizontal Transition
Window heads, door tops, roof-to-wall intersections, and any horizontal trim board need proper flashing that sheds water outward and downward, not sealant alone. In driving rain, flashing does the work that caulk simply can't do reliably over time.
Fastening and Reveal Consistency
Panels and battens need to be fastened per the manufacturer's nailing pattern, with consistent reveal spacing so the wall both looks straight and performs as designed. Over- or under-driven fasteners, or battens spaced by eye instead of layout, are an easy tell of a rushed job.
Sealant Used Correctly, Not as a Crutch
Sealant has a real, limited job at specific joints — it's not a substitute for flashing or a drainage gap. Installations that lean on caulk to do the flashing's job tend to fail first, because caulk is the first material to crack, shrink, or pull away under years of UV and freeze-thaw cycling.
Mistakes We See on Vertical Siding Not Built for This Climate
- Battens installed tight against the field panel with no drainage path behind them
- Panels run down to grade or pavement with no clearance, wicking ground moisture
- Missing kickout flashing where a roofline meets a sidewall, sending roof runoff straight down the siding
- Butt joints between panels with no proper flashing or H-mold, relying on caulk alone
- Inconsistent batten spacing that traps water at inside corners
None of these are visible from the curb on installation day. They show up two, five, or ten years later as staining, soft spots, or paint failure — which is exactly why the installation details matter more than the finished appearance on day one.

Cost Factors for a Ferndale Board and Batten Project
| Factor | Why It Moves the Price |
|---|---|
| Total wall area | More square footage means more material and labor hours |
| Existing siding removal | Tear-off, disposal, and sheathing repair add time versus a new-construction install |
| Number of stories / access | Taller walls need more scaffolding or lift time, which affects labor cost |
| Trim and corner complexity | More window openings, corners, and transitions mean more flashing and trim detail work |
| Color selection | Standard ColorPlus tones versus premium finishes carry different material costs |
| Hidden moisture damage | If tear-off reveals rotten sheathing or framing, that repair is additional scope |
Because so much of the final cost depends on what's actually behind the existing siding, a firm number really only comes from an in-person look at the walls.
Maintenance Board and Batten Needs in a Marine Climate
Fiber cement is low-maintenance compared to wood, but "low" isn't "none" in a climate like this one. A yearly rinse to knock off accumulated moss and airborne salt residue keeps the ColorPlus finish looking its best, and it's worth a quick visual check of caulk lines at windows and trim once a year — sealant is a wear item on any siding system and is cheap to touch up before it fails outright. Keeping gutters clear and downspouts directed away from the wall also goes a long way, since concentrated roof runoff is one of the more common causes of localized siding problems.

Questions worth asking any contractor bidding board and batten work:
- Will there be a rainscreen or drainage gap behind the panels, and how is it created?
- What flashing details are planned at windows, doors, and roof-to-wall transitions?
- Which Hardie panel and trim products are being used, and in what reveal width?
- Is sheathing inspected and repaired before new siding goes on, or covered over as-is?
- What does the manufacturer's warranty actually cover, and does it require a certified installer?
